最近在php下做关于Socket通讯的相关内容,发现网络上好多人在了解如何进行16进制收发,研究了下,代码如下,欢迎拍砖。 <?php $sendStr = '30 32 30 34 03 30 33'; // 16进制数据 $sendStrArray ...
参考:http: m.blog.csdn.net blog JasonQue 具体的struct模块的解释可以参照上面的链接。 struct.pack也就是将数据按照二进制的格式进行传输 usr bin env python coding:utf author ferraborghini from socket import import struct 将 进制数据当做字节流传递 def data ...
2015-11-16 22:58 0 9279 推荐指数:
最近在php下做关于Socket通讯的相关内容,发现网络上好多人在了解如何进行16进制收发,研究了下,代码如下,欢迎拍砖。 <?php $sendStr = '30 32 30 34 03 30 33'; // 16进制数据 $sendStrArray ...
前记 python涉及到和硬件互交的部分,一般是需要发送十六进制的帧长的。所以,python这个转换还是经常使用的。笔者在这里遇到了一个问题。就做一个记录吧。 基本方法: 假如你熟悉python的话,这个是非常简单的,就只需要把int类型的数取从第二位开始的数据就行了:如下所述 ...
转:8位16位32位数据的拆分与合并程序 https://blog.csdn.net/qq_31811537/article/details/71760334 拆分 //16位拆成两个8位 u16 data16 = 0x1234; u8 data8_H,data8_L ...
16进制节码解析 前言: 之前我们介绍了modbus_tk数据传输,当然只是介绍了最基本的modbus_tk使用方法, 在使用时我们常用”16进制节码“传输内容今天就简单介绍一个16进制节码解析的实例 从机:float形式数据 主机: python:modbus_tk ...
Python读取返回16进制解决方法 import codecscodecs.open(r'C:\ProgramData\Sangfor\EDR\log\sfavui.log', 'r', 'utf-16-le').readline() ...
string input = "Hello World!" ; char [] values = input.ToCharArray(); foreach ( cha ...